WASHINGTON DC – […] Since serving as the interim U.S. attorney, Mr. Martin has worked to dismantle the office’s investigations into those who participated in the attack on the Capitol. The U.S. Attorney’s Office in the District of Columbia led the probe, charging more than 1,500 people.
Mr. Martin also fired about two dozen prosecutors who oversaw the Jan. 6 investigations. He launched a review of how the U.S. Attorney’s Office used the charge of obstructing an official proceeding against hundreds of pro-Trump protesters.
The U.S. Supreme Court last year ruled that the obstruction charge only applied in the few Jan. 6 cases when the defendant tampered or destroyed documents. The decision severely limited the use of the charge in the Jan. 6 cases and resulted in some convicts receiving reduced sentences and others getting released from jail. (link)

‘ The $1.7 trillion government funding bill released Tuesday [Dec 20, 2022] includes extra money for the Justice Department to prosecute Jan. 6 cases. Congress hopes to pass it this week.
‘The Justice Department had requested $34 million from Congress specifically to carry on the [J6] investigation.
‘The House Appropriations Committee, which is led by Democrats for two more weeks, justified the boost in funding for U.S. attorneys in a separate statement by citing “heightened prosecution workload arising from the U.S. Capitol attack and domestic terrorism cases.”
The funding legislation, negotiated by House Speaker Nancy Pelosi, D-Calif., and Senate Majority Leader Chuck Schumer, D-N.Y, has the backing of key Senate Republicans, like Minority Leader Mitch McConnell of Kentucky and Appropriations Committee Vice Chair Richard Shelby of Alabama, putting it in a strong position to get the 60 votes needed to break a filibuster and pass the Senate.
“I’ve always been for prosecuting anybody who violated the law on January the 6th,” said Sen. Roy Blunt, R-Mo., a senior appropriator and member of Republican leadership. “And there are, like, 800 cases already. So I can’t imagine that they don’t need some extra money.”
